What is the difference between avatar video and script to video?
Avatar video centers on a digital presenter speaking your words directly to camera, like a virtual spokesperson. Script to video instead assembles a full edited clip from your text, stitching stock footage, b-roll, voiceover, and captions into scenes. One puts a synthetic person on screen; the other builds a montage around your script.
Can I create a custom AI avatar of myself?
Yes, most avatar tools let you build a custom avatar from a short recording of yourself or an actor. You film a couple of minutes reading a consent script, upload it, and the tool trains a digital twin you can later drive with text. Custom avatars usually sit on paid plans.
Are AI avatar videos free to make?
Many avatar tools have a free tier, but it comes with watermarks and short time limits, often a minute or two per video. Stock avatars are usually free to use, while custom avatars, longer exports, and watermark removal sit behind paid plans that typically start around twenty to thirty dollars a month.
Do AI avatars look realistic?
The best AI avatars look convincing in short, head-on clips, though longer takes and side angles still reveal small tells in the eyes and mouth. Voice quality has improved a lot, so the audio often sounds natural. For polished, believable results, stick to clear lighting in your source footage and shorter segments.
